[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[Minios-devel] [UNIKRAFT PATCH 0/5] lib/nolibc: import asprintf from musl


  • To: minios-devel@xxxxxxxxxxxxx
  • From: Costin Lupu <costin.lupu@xxxxxxxxx>
  • Date: Wed, 1 Aug 2018 11:02:17 +0300
  • Cc: florian.schmidt@xxxxxxxxx, simon.kuenzer@xxxxxxxxx, yuri.volchkov@xxxxxxxxx
  • Delivery-date: Wed, 01 Aug 2018 08:02:36 +0000
  • Ironport-phdr: 9a23:HY5T2hwkFoY41X3XCy+O+j09IxM/srCxBDY+r6Qd2ukWIJqq85mqBkHD//Il1AaPAd2Fraocw8Pt8InYEVQa5piAtH1QOLdtbDQizfssogo7HcSeAlf6JvO5JwYzHcBFSUM3tyrjaRsdF8nxfUDdrWOv5jAOBBr/KRB1JuPoEYLOksi7ze+/94HSbglSmDaxfa55IQmrownWqsQYm5ZpJLwryhvOrHtIeuBWyn1tKFmOgRvy5dq+8YB6/ShItP0v68BPUaPhf6QlVrNYFygpM3o05MLwqxbOSxaE62YGXWUXlhpIBBXF7A3/U5zsvCb2qvZx1S+HNsDwULs6Wymt771zRRHolikJKjA3/mLQhMFrkK5XvAisqwBlzoLIfI2YMud1cKPHfdMdQGpMRthcVytaAoOgbosPCfcKM+BFr4nlulsFsByzChWrBOP01j9Ih3n20bc+0+Q8CQHGwRctEM4VsHjOtNX1KbwdXfqvzKnP1DjOae5d1zTl6IXQbxwsruyAUahzfMfR00UjCR3Jg1eKpYHrJz+Zy+sAv3WB4+djVe+jkXArpg9/rzS128shhZfFi4QIwV7e7yp52pw6JdigRU5+Zt6rDYVfujmBN4tzXsMiW2ZouDsmyrEeuZ60YiwKyJM/yh7BbvyIaYmI4hb5WOmNOjd0nmpleK+kiBqo60igzfXwVsiy0FlUsipIisTAu38Q2xDJ6cWKSuFx8lm/1TuNzQze5PlIIUUumqraL54hzKQwlp0WsUnbAiD2n172jLOXdkUi4OSo7/nnYq37ppKHK4B0kRvyMrwzmsOkG+g4KA8OU3CB+eugzL3j4VH5QLJSg/0zk6nZtpHaJcMApqKgHgBazJgj5Ai7Dzq91NQYnGIHLE5eeB6dgInmJVfOLOr/DfeljFSmiC1ryOzePr39HpXNKWDOkLnlfbZ68U5cyRA8zdZF65JPFr4BIPfzWk7su9zEFRI5NRK7zPrjCNpnzYwSQ3yAArKBOqPIrVCI/v4vI/WLZIINozb9Kv0l5/nojXMjml8dYLem3Z0WaX+mBPRrOEOZbmTwjdcFC2gFpRAyQ/L3iFeaSz5ce26yX74g5jE8EI+nDZrDRpqsgLCbwie7GZlWaXxGClCPFnfoaZ6JW/ESZy2OJs9uiCcLWaK/RI88hlmSs1r/yrxmKfGR9iAGuJbL0Nlu+/aVhRw0sztuAJezyWaIGkpzhX8JQXcSwbhi6Rh2zUyf0K4+h+FACPRY/LVRTw18L5mKnL8yMMz7Rg+UJoTBc12hWNjzWTw=
  • List-id: Mini-os development list <minios-devel.lists.xenproject.org>

Import and adapt asprintf code from musl.
As suggested by Yuri Volchov in the Xenbus patch review for v1.

Costin Lupu (5):
  lib/nolibc: import asprintf from musl
  lib/nolibc: use a single file for both asprintf and vasprintf
  lib/nolibc: set license for asprintf.c
  lib/nolibc: fix checkpatch issues for asprintf.c
  lib/nolibc: use asprintf in Unikraft

 lib/nolibc/Makefile.uk     |  1 +
 lib/nolibc/asprintf.c      | 51 ++++++++++++++++++++++++++++++++++++++++++++++
 lib/nolibc/include/stdio.h |  3 +++
 3 files changed, 55 insertions(+)
 create mode 100644 lib/nolibc/asprintf.c

-- 
2.11.0


_______________________________________________
Minios-devel mailing list
Minios-devel@xxxxxxxxxxxxxxxxxxxx
https://lists.xenproject.org/mailman/listinfo/minios-devel

 


Rackspace

Lists.xenproject.org is hosted with RackSpace, monitoring our
servers 24x7x365 and backed by RackSpace's Fanatical Support®.